Output deb28e61b521f6738eb2139ecbe115e894049fbdfd8b2b8d8e7dea7e82c85c5a:0

value
3074084
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b98604d12a6ae61a13db4ebdaf8e475b39a16743 OP_EQUALVERIFY OP_CHECKSIG
address
1HuxZHCQZCcLbFWYHAsTtKaq77wAwEryYz
transaction
deb28e61b521f6738eb2139ecbe115e894049fbdfd8b2b8d8e7dea7e82c85c5a
spent
true